/PLMI/LBL_SVIEWT is a standard SAP Table which is used to store OBSOLETE. DONT USE! data and is available within R/3 SAP systems depending on the version and release level.
The /PLMI/LBL_SVIEWT table consists of various fields, each holding specific information or linking keys about OBSOLETE. DONT USE! data available in SAP. These include LANGU (Language Key), SV_ID (ID of Subview), SV_NAME (Name of Subview).. SAP /PLMI/LBL_SVIEWT table fields - Full list of fields found in SAP data dictionary
Field | Description | Data Element | Data Type | length (Dec) | Check table | Conversion Routine | Domain Name | MemoryID | SHLP |
MANDT | Client | MANDT | CLNT | 3 | Assigned to domain | MANDT | |||
LANGU | Language Key | LANGU | LANG | 1 | T002 | ISOLA | SPRAS | ||
SV_ID | ID of Subview | /PLMB/LBL_SV_ID | CHAR | 10 | /PLMI/LBL_SVIEW | CHAR10 | |||
SV_NAME | Name of Subview | /PLMB/LBL_SV_NAME | CHAR | 40 | TEXT40 |
